Next LASER: June 10, 2009
Leonardo Art Science Evening Rendezvous (LASER) is a series of lectures and presentations on art, science and technology organized by Piero Scaruffi on behalf of Leonardo/ISAST. Join us in Mountain View at the SETI Institute for the next LASER with feature presentations by Sheila Pinkel, Robert Edgar, Liena Vayzman and Roger Malina. FIND OUT MORE

Join Leonardo/Olats at e-MobiLArt Symposium
LEONARDO/Olats, co-sponsor of e-MobiLArt, is pleased to announce the e-MobiLArt Symposium, 21 - 22 May 2009, Thessaloniki, Greece. During the symposium a short presentation of the project and its activities will take place. Participating artists' groups will talk about their collaborative experience and will present their exhibited artworks. This will be followed by two panel discussions on the curatorial, artistic and organizational perspectives into the collaborative process. Invited lecturers in the symposium are Roger Malina, Claudine Dussolier, Ekmel Ertan and the creative team NeMe. FIND OUT MORE

Lovely Weather Artist Residencies, Donegal, Ireland
Donegal County Council's Public Art Office in partnership with Leonardo/OLATS seeks expressions of interest from artists for one of five residencies (4-11 weeks) exploring how art can address issues around global warming and climate change in County Donegal. FIND OUT MORE

Join Leonardo Community Member Edward Shanken at the Exploratorium for Book Signing, Conversation and Reception
Interdisciplinary arts scholar Edward Shanken, the author of Art and Electronic Media (Phaidon, 2009), will be interviewed by arts commentator Dorka Keen at the Exploratorium (San Francisco, CA) on Sunday, June 7 at 3pm, followed by a signing and reception. Art and Electronic Media, the highly anticipated book by Shanken, demonstrates the formidable history of artistic uses of electronic media, a history that parallels the growing pervasiveness of technology in all facets of life.
